Most kitchens people want rid of are structurally fine. The carcasses are sound, the layout works, the worktop has years left in it — it is the colour that has dated. Painting them costs a fraction of replacing them and takes days rather than weeks, with no skip on the drive.

The finish stands or falls on the preparation, which is almost entirely invisible in the finished photographs. Kitchen doors carry years of cooking grease, and paint will not key to it. Everything is degreased, rubbed down, and any chips or dents filled before a primer suited to the surface goes on — melamine, oak, MDF and previously painted units all want different products.

Hardware comes off rather than being cut around. Handles, hinges and plates are removed, the doors are finished properly, and it all goes back at the end. It takes longer, and it is the reason the edges look sharp instead of gummed up.

What the job actually involves

  1. Degrease, then rub down

    Years of cooking residue removed first, because nothing sticks to it.

  2. Fill and make good

    Chips, dents and worn edges filled and sanded flat.

  3. Prime for the surface

    Melamine, oak, MDF and already-painted doors each need a different primer.

  4. Hand or spray finish

    Sprayed off site for the flattest finish, or brushed in place where that suits the job better.

  5. Hardware back on

    Handles and hinges taken off at the start and refitted at the end.
